Now in its fourth printing, Valley of the Rogues is the first factual study of the vanished Rogue Indians, their customs, living conditions and life style. The volume is used by many schools of Southern Oregon as a study to the native Americans of the Rogue Valley. The book, now in its fourth printing, continues to be the definitive publication of a unique tribe of people who made their home in the rugged canyons of the Rogue River and were as turbulent in life as the River that bears their name.
